Abstract

The relevance of the topic of the article lies in the fact that there is age discrimination of older people, which raises the question of the quality of life of the elderly population. The purpose of the article is to consider the types of ageism, its causes, and measures to eliminate them in the representatives of the younger generation. The research materials were scientific articles and websites of well-known organizations. Research methods: study of various sources of information, analysis of the information obtained, synthesis, deduction, induction. The results of the study. The article describes the types of ageism, such as open ageism, latent ageism, everyday ageism, self-ageism. The main causes of ageism are noted. These include gerontophobia, negative stereotypes, declining status of the elderly, low culture in society, lack of geriatrics and gerontology programs in full, insufficiently qualified personnel in the field of health care, social services. Measures to eliminate manifestations of ageism among the younger generation should include the use of various media, the development and monitoring of gerontological ageism in medical centers and social institutions, the audit of clinical, managerial, strategic and financial documents defining age restrictions for access to treatment, medicines or services, the formation of social and medical employees, as well as future specialists studying in these specialties, skills of self-reflection of attitudes towards aging and the elderly, increasing the competence of social and medical workers in the field of geriatrics and gerontology through appropriate courses. In conclusion, it is concluded that the state policy should be aimed at expanding legislation, writing various projects and programs about older people that will help overcome poor awareness of this issue and change negative stereotypes about aging to positive ones. Efforts should be made to stimulate contacts between representatives of different generations, facilitating communication and interaction between them.
